Ir daudz veidu, kā izmantot attālo darbvirsmu savām vajadzībām. Šis raksts parādīs, kā iestatīt attālo darbvirsmu Linux.
Attālā darbvirsma Linux
Ir vairāki dažādi veidi, kā iestatīt attālo darbvirsmu Linux. Kas attiecas uz CLI, SSH, iespējams, ir labākā metode, ko to izmantot. Ja meklējat GUI attālo darbvirsmu, ir pieejamas daudzas citas iespējas. Šajā rakstā tiks aplūkoti daži no populārākajiem veidiem, kā izmantot attālo darbvirsmu o \ Linux.
Dažas katra rīka funkcijas vai īpašības var atšķirties atkarībā no izplatīšanas veida. Šim rakstam es izmantoju Ubuntu.
TeamViewer
Starp visiem attālajiem darbvirsmas rīkiem TeamViewer ir viens no labākajiem. Tas ir freemium modelis, kas nozīmē, ka jūs varat izmantot bāzes versiju bez maksas un maksāt par lielākām iespējām un piekļuvi programmatūrai. Lai iespējotu attālo savienojumu, abās ierīcēs jābūt instalētai TeamViewer.
TeamViewer ir starpplatformu rīks, kas pieejams Windows, Linux, macOS un citām operētājsistēmām. Lai instalētu Linux, paņemiet savai sistēmai atbilstošo Linux pakotni. Lejupielādējiet TeamViewer šeit.
Manā gadījumā, tā kā es izmantoju Ubuntu, es paķēru DEB paketi. Ja izmantojat openSUSE, RHEL, CentOS vai Fedora, jums būs jāpaķer RPM pakotne.
Lai instalētu DEB pakotni Ubuntu, palaidiet šādu komandu terminālā.
$ sudo apt install ./ teamviewer_15.7.6_amd64.deb
Lai instalētu RPM pakotni openSUSE vai SUSE Linux, palaidiet šādu komandu.
$ sudo zypper instalēt ./ komandas skatītājs.x86_64.apgr./minLai instalētu RPM pakotni RHEL vai CentOS, palaidiet šo komandu.
$ sudo yum install ./ komandas skatītājs.x86_64.apgr./minLai Fedora instalētu RPM pakotni, palaidiet šo komandu.
$ sudo dnf localinstall teamviewer.x86_64.apgr./minJa izmantojat Arch Linux vai Arch-atvasinājumus, šeit varat paķert TeamViewer no AUR.
Kad instalēšana ir pabeigta, palaidiet lietotni.
Pieņemiet licences līgumu.
TeamViewer tagad ir gatavs izveidot attālās darbvirsmas savienojumu. ID un parole būs nepieciešama, lai kāds cits varētu izveidot savienojumu ar sistēmu. Ņemiet vērā, ka tie ir nejauši un īslaicīgi. Ir iespējams konfigurēt pielāgotus akreditācijas datus un pastāvīgus pieteikumvārdus. Tomēr jums būs nepieciešams TeamViewer konts. Pagaidām mēs izveidosim pamata TeamViewer attālās darbvirsmas savienojumu.
Ievadiet attālās darbvirsmas partnera ID un noklikšķiniet uz “Connect.”
TeamViewer pieprasīs attālās darbvirsmas paroli.
Voilà! Attālā darbvirsma ir veiksmīgi konfigurēta!
Remmina
Remmina ir bezmaksas un atvērtā koda attālās darbvirsmas klients. Tāpat kā TeamViewer, arī Remmina ir pieejama visām galvenajām platformām. Remmina atbalsta dažādus attālās darbvirsmas tīkla protokolus, tostarp VNC, SSH, RDP, NX un XDMCP.
Atšķirībā no TeamViewer, Remmina nav ierobežojumu attiecībā uz tā lietošanu. Remmina var izmantot gan personīgai, gan profesionālai (sistēmas administrators, serveris un citi) slodzei. Tas padara Remmina neticami ienesīgu gan vispārējiem, gan profesionāliem lietotājiem.
Ņemiet vērā, ka Remmina ir tikai klients, kurš, izmantojot atbalstītos protokolus, var izveidot savienojumu ar visiem jūsu attālajiem galddatoriem. Attālajiem galddatoriem jābūt konfigurētiem ar attālo darbvirsmas serveri (VNC serveri, SSH, NoMachine serveri utt.), lai Remmina varētu tiem piekļūt.
Ir vairāki veidi, kā instalēt Remmina. Atkarībā no izplatīšanas metode būs atšķirīga. Šeit skatiet oficiālo Remmina instalēšanas rokasgrāmatu.
Šajā sadaļā tiks apskatīts, kā instalēt Remmina snap un flatpak. Tās ir universālas Linux paketes, tāpēc jūs varat tās izbaudīt jebkurā distro, kuru izmantojat.
Lai instalētu Remmina snap, palaidiet šo komandu. Ņemiet vērā, ka jūsu sistēmā jau ir jābūt instalētam snap (pakotņu pakotņu pārvaldniekam).
$ sudo snap install remmina
Lai instalētu Remmina flatpak, palaidiet šādu komandu. Tāpat kā ar snap, vispirms būs jāinstalē snap pakotņu pārvaldnieks.
$ sudo flatpak instalējiet flathub org.remmina.Remmina
Kad instalēšana ir pabeigta, palaidiet rīku.
Es izveidošu savienojumu ar attālo Ubuntu sistēmu, kas jau ir konfigurēta ar VNC serveri. Lai izveidotu savienojumu ar attālo darbvirsmu, ar peles labo pogu noklikšķiniet un atlasiet “Connect.”
NoMachine
TeamViewer ir spēcīga, viegli lietojama attālās darbvirsmas programmatūra, taču tai ir cena enerģijas lietotājiem. Remmina gadījumā tas ir bez maksas, taču jums ir jāiziet VNC konfigurēšana mērķa mašīnā. Ja vien būtu risinājums, kas būtu spēcīgs, ērti lietojams un bez maksas!
NoMachine ir tāds attālās darbvirsmas risinājums. Tās funkcijas var būt vienādas ar TeamViewer, vienlaikus bez maksas. Tas var likties mazliet aizdomīgi cilvēkiem, kurus interesē privātums. Jums var būt jautājums, kā NoMachine iegūst naudu, kas vajadzīga, lai uzturētu sevi? Saskaņā ar NoMachine teikto, viņu ienākumu avots pārdod savu programmatūru uzņēmumiem. NoMachine nevāc nekādus personas datus, kā arī ieņēmumiem neizmanto AdWords.
NoMachine ir starpplatformu rīks, kas pieejams Windows, Linux un MacOS. Linux gadījumā NoMachine ir pieejams DEB (Debian, Ubuntu un atvasinājumiem) un RPM (Fedora, SUSE, RHEL, CentOS un atvasinājumi) paketēs. Ja jūs izmantojat Arch Linux (vai atvasinājumus), pārbaudiet NoMachine vietnē AUR šeit.
Lejupielādējiet NoMachine šeit.
Lai instalētu DEB pakotni Debian, Ubuntu un atvasinājumos, palaidiet šādu komandu.
$ sudo apt install ./ nomachine_6.11.2_1_amd64.deb
Lai instalētu RPM pakotni openSUSE, SUSE Linux un atvasinājumos, palaidiet šādu komandu.
$ sudo zypper instalēt ./ nomachine_6.11.2_1_x86_64.apgr./minLai instalētu RPM pakotni Fedora (izmantojot dnf), palaidiet šo komandu.
$ sudo dnf localinstall nomachine_6.11.2_1_x86_64.apgr./minLai instalētu RPM pakotni CentOS, RHEL un atvasinājumos, palaidiet šo komandu.
$ sudo yum install ./ nomachine_6.11.2_1_x86_64.apgr./minNoMachine ir divas daļas: NoMachine serveris un NoMachine klients. Serveris būs atbildīgs par atļauju citiem NoMachine klientiem izveidot savienojumu ar sistēmu. Klients tiks izmantots šo attālo darbvirsmu savienošanai un lietošanai.
Pirmkārt, mēs pārbaudīsim NoMachine serveri. Palaidiet serveri NoMachine.
Parādīsies servera statusa logs NoMachine. Ir 4 cilnes. Pirmais ir “Servera statuss.”Šeit jūs varat redzēt servera IP adresi. Ir arī servera apturēšanas, restartēšanas un izslēgšanas iespējas.
Pēc tam mēs pārbaudīsim cilni “Servera preferences”. Šeit jūs varat konfigurēt servera darbību.
Tālāk mēs pārbaudīsim klientu NoMachine. Šis klients tiks izmantots, lai izveidotu savienojumu ar NoMachine attālo darbvirsmu.
Lai pievienotu attālās darbvirsmas savienojumu, noklikšķiniet uz pogas “Jauns”.
NoMachine sāks jauno savienojuma izveides procesu. Vispirms atlasiet protokolu. Ir divi pieejamie protokoli: NX un SSH. GUI attālajai darbvirsmai ieteicams izmantot NX.
Ievadiet NoMachine servera IP un portu.
Nākamais solis ir autentifikācijas metode. Lielāko daļu laika tā būs “Parole.”
NoMachine jautās, vai vēlaties konfigurēt konkrētu savienojuma starpniekserveri. Ja nav starpniekservera, kuru vēlaties iestatīt, atlasiet “Nelietot starpniekserveri.”
Piešķiriet savienojumam nosaukumu. Nosaukumam vajadzētu būt kaut kam, kas ļauj viegli atpazīt sistēmu.
Savienojums ir iestatīts! Ar peles labo pogu noklikšķiniet un atlasiet Sākt savienojumu, lai izveidotu savienojumu ar attālo darbvirsmu.
Ievadiet attālās darbvirsmas lietotājvārdu un paroli.
Kad būs izveidots savienojums, NoMachine parādīs dažus ātrus programmatūras izmantošanas padomus un ieteikumus.
Voila! Izbaudiet attālo darbvirsmu!
Ņemiet vērā, ka Remmina ir saderīga arī ar NoMachine serveri.
Secinājums
Atkarībā no darba slodzes izvēlieties piemērotu risinājumu savām vajadzībām. Visas šeit minētās attālās darbvirsmas programmatūras pakotnes ir paredzētas GUI attālajai darbvirsmai. Ja vēlaties tikai piekļūt, izmantojot komandrindu, SSH ir labākais risinājums. Pārbaudiet, kā konfigurēt un izmantot SSH operētājsistēmā Linux šeit. Daļa apmācības ir specifiska Ubuntu, bet pārējā ir piemērojama jebkuram izplatītājam.
Izbaudi!